Transaction 124c92022b70091f2ab376f8609357c498981f37528d59882097ec1bc8164e3d

3 Input
2 Outputs
  • 124c92022b70091f2ab376f8609357c498981f37528d59882097ec1bc8164e3d:0
  • value  15694715
    address  16VGZ1HcqzXSa9Ef7ad6KxZRVmpbLKjaP7
  • 124c92022b70091f2ab376f8609357c498981f37528d59882097ec1bc8164e3d:1
  • value  2063367
    address  1KNHpt4UTgDfU2DcxWtXmZN73hFBBUP6gP